0 216 593 0844
trendefr
Sosyal Medya Hesaplarımız

Базовые-принципы функционирования PowerShell-среды

18 Mayıs 2026
8 kez görüntülendi
Базовые-принципы функционирования PowerShell-среды

Базовые-принципы функционирования PowerShell-среды

PowerShell-среда представляет по-сути средство терминальной строки а-также язык командных-сценариев, разработанный для оптимизации процессов плюс администрирования инфраструктурой. Инструмент применяется с-целью запуска инструкций, настройки операционной системы, администрирования компонентов и анализа данных. В-отличие отличие с традиционных терминальных оболочек, Windows-PowerShell взаимодействует не-только лишь со строками, однако а-также со данными, это усиливает инструменты мани х казино изучения и контроля.

В-рамках современных системах PowerShell-среда применяется для упрощения повседневных действий а-также создания автоматических цепочек. Во прикладных материалах и прикладных примерах, среди-них мани-х, часто объясняется, по-какой-схеме с использованием PowerShell можно управлять документами, службами и network параметрами без-применения применения графического UI.

Ключевые принципы функционирования Windows-PowerShell

PowerShell-среда построен вокруг идеи командлетов — служебных встроенных операций, каждая в-числе которых проводит точную функцию. Cmdlet-команды получают типовую структуру обозначений, как-правило состоящую из команды и существительного. Такой принцип формирует инструкции значительно логичными и последовательными.

Каждый встроенная-команда выдает объект, а не-просто строчную запись. Это означает, когда результат реально передавать во иные операции без ручной проверки. Такой механизм позволяет формировать цепочки действий, внутри которых данные последовательно передаются несколькими инструментами.

Использование через PowerShell-среде строится посредством структурированного выполнения команд. Специалист а-также командный-файл указывает команды, а система проводит действия согласно установленном порядке. Посредством этому возможно создавать скрипты, они без-ручного-участия запускают развитые процессы без ручного контроля мани х.

Встроенные-команды и их схема

Cmdlet-команды выступают фундаментом PowerShell-среды. Командлеты получают стандартизированный принцип названия, например Get-Process, Set-Location а-также Remove-Item. Действие показывает действие, и существительное называет объект, с которым указанное операция запускается.

Cmdlet-команды имеют-возможность использовать аргументы, они конкретизируют параметры запуска. Допустим, возможно задать точный файл, папку либо процесс. Аргументы дают-возможность адаптировать money x операцию под-нужную точную операцию плюс формируют процесс более адаптивной.

Вывод выполнения встроенной-команды можно поместить во переменную либо направить следом по конвейеру. Такой-подход позволяет комбинировать командлеты плюс разрабатывать более сложные цепочки, построенные из ряда команд.

Операции со структурами

Ключевой в-числе основных черт PowerShell-среды выступает работа со структурами. В сравнение по-сравнению-с классических оболочек, где инструкции передают текст, PowerShell-среда отправляет упорядоченные данные. Каждый объект имеет параметры плюс методы, которые возможно задействовать для следующей проверки.

Например, во-время получении набора служб PowerShell возвращает не-только лишь записи при именами, а элементы вместе-с данными об любом мани х казино элементе. Такой-подход помогает отбирать, распределять и корректировать информацию без лишних операций.

Работа через объектами облегчает анализ данных плюс делает цепочки намного надежными. Возможно извлекать исключительно требуемые параметры, выполнять сравнения а-также задействовать фильтры без сложных манипуляций над строками.

Цепочка PowerShell-среды

Цепочка позволяет направлять итог первой инструкции в иную. Такая-функция одна из основных инструментов PowerShell. Посредством конвейера использованием можно связывать ряд операций во одну цепочку, когда каждая инструкция преобразует информацию, принятые от ранней.

Данный подход делает скрипты лаконичными и понятными. Без формирования временных результатов а-также значений реально сразу направлять итог следом. Подобная-логика ускоряет проведение задач плюс сокращает вероятность мани х ошибок.

Цепочка активно используется во-время фильтрации информации, получении требуемых объектов и запуске связанных команд. Конвейер выступает важной составляющей логики использования PowerShell-среды.

Значения плюс размещение сведений

Значения в Windows-PowerShell используются ради записи информации, она имеет-возможность быть применена позже. Они помечаются маркером доллара и имеют-возможность хранить несколько типы значений, содержа текст, показатели, списки а-также объекты.

Задействование переменных позволяет записывать промежуточные выводы плюс оптимизирует работу со многоэтапными цепочками. Вместо нового проведения одной а-также аналогичной же команды реально сохранить результат и применить его снова.

Переменные еще дают-возможность организовывать скрипт плюс формируют его значительно читаемым. Данный-фактор особенно значимо money x в-процессе создании крупных сценариев, где нужно контролировать множеством данных.

Командные-файлы для PowerShell-среде

Windows-PowerShell позволяет разработку сценариев — файлов при расширением .ps1, включающих цепочку операций. Скрипты позволяют упростить операции плюс выполнять операции регулярно без-ручного прямого набора.

Командные-файлы способны содержать правила, циклы плюс методы. Подобная-структура формирует сценарии самостоятельным механизмом для выполнения развитых задач. Командные-файлы задействуются для подготовки сред, обработки сведений плюс запуска постоянных операций.

До выполнением скриптов критично проверять настройки контроля системы. PowerShell-среда мани х казино имеет-возможность блокировать запуск сценариев ради предотвращения от вредоносного ПО. Вследствие-этого необходимо правильно задавать права и использовать лишь доверенные файлы.

Отбор а-также анализ сведений

PowerShell обеспечивает инструменты для селекции плюс преобразования сведений. Посредством их использованием можно получать исключительно подходящие значения, распределять элементы и проводить многочисленные операции.

Селекция позволяет сократить количество данных а-также направить-внимание на-важных ключевых элементах. Данный-подход мани х в-особенности актуально при работе с большими наборами процессов либо объектов.

Анализ данных может содержать преобразование форматов, соединение данных и проведение вычислений. Такие действия часто используются в оптимизации а-также аналитике.

Управление через файлами а-также средой

PowerShell активно используется ради контроля файлами плюс каталогами. С данного-инструмента помощью реально создавать, удалять, смещать плюс изменять файлы. Кроме-того возможно открывать контент директорий money x и запускать сканирование.

Помимо взаимодействия через ресурсами, PowerShell-среда помогает управлять сервисами, службами а-также настройками системы. Данный-фактор создает инструмент удобным инструментом ради обслуживания.

Скрипты имеют-возможность самостоятельно выполнять запасное сохранение, удалять временные файлы и отслеживать операции внутри платформе. Такой-подход помогает сохранять устойчивость и стабильность системы.

Удаленное контроль

Windows-PowerShell позволяет дистанционное проведение инструкций. Данный-механизм позволяет контролировать удаленными компьютерами а-также системами без-прямого локального взаимодействия к устройствам. Подобный подход активно используется для мани х казино корпоративных средах.

Сетевое управление дает-возможность выполнять операции централизованно. Допустим, возможно модифицировать цифровое обеспечение на-нескольких множестве узлах параллельно а-также проверить их.

Для во сетевом режиме используются специальные инструменты и конфигурации защиты. Такая-система создает защиту сведений и ограничение прав.

Контроль Windows-PowerShell

PowerShell обеспечивает средства безопасности, которые контролируют исполнение скриптов. Это нужно ради предотвращения запуска опасных файлов. Среда способна требовать электронную подтверждение либо право на-выполнение исполнение файлов.

Необходимо контролировать политику контроля во-время взаимодействии через Windows-PowerShell. Нежелательно мани х исполнять неизвестные скрипты а-также настраивать параметры без-оценки анализа результатов.

Контроль разрешений плюс анализ сценариев помогают снизить вероятность-ошибок а-также создают надежную работу системы. Корректное использование PowerShell-среды выступает важной основой администрирования.

Практическое применение PowerShell

Windows-PowerShell применяется в разных сферах, охватывая управление, создание-решений плюс анализ данных. PowerShell позволяет упрощать задачи, контролировать money x системами плюс анализировать информацию.

С PowerShell использованием можно формировать сводки, подготавливать окружение, управлять учетными-записями а-также запускать развитые операции. Это создает PowerShell-среду универсальным механизмом ради взаимодействия через системой.

Расширяемость а-также масштабируемость дают-возможность подстраивать PowerShell под точные сценарии. Инструмент сохраняется популярным решением во нынешних цифровых инфраструктурах.

Дополнительные возможности и расширения

Windows-PowerShell поддерживает расширение возможностей за использование расширений. Модуль представляет собой совокупность командлетов, процедур а-также ресурсов, связанных во общий набор. С-помощью модулей применением можно добавлять дополнительные возможности без перестройки главной среды. Например, существуют пакеты с-целью работы со облачными системами, хранилищами информации мани х казино а-также сетевыми протоколами.

Подключение модулей дает-возможность использовать новые инструкции так-же же удобно, подобно базовые инструменты. Такая-возможность делает Windows-PowerShell адаптивным а-также адаптируемым под многочисленные цели. Администраторы а-также создатели имеют-возможность создавать собственные расширения, они отвечают точным задачам среды.

Также PowerShell обеспечивает ведение журналов и журналирование. Командные-файлы способны записывать информацию касательно выполнении, сохранять ошибки а-также сохранять результаты операций. Данный-механизм необходимо для оценки, отладки и контроля операций. Логи помогают понять, конкретные действия проводились плюс во какой-именно мани х очередности.

Исключения а-также их устранение

Во-время взаимодействии со скриптами могут появляться проблемы, вызванные с правами, нехваткой документов а-также ошибочными аргументами. PowerShell-среда содержит средства контроля таких случаев. Скрипт может валидировать параметры исполнения а-также действовать в-случае ошибки.

Обработка исключений помогает предотвратить остановки выполнения и создает устойчивую эксплуатацию. Сценарий имеет-возможность вывести предупреждение, сохранить инцидент в журнал а-также провести альтернативное операцию. Такой-подход делает автоматизацию намного стабильной а-также устойчивой.

Правильная работа со исключениями в-особенности значима для сложных скриптах, когда подключено ряд модулей. Обработка сбоев дает-возможность сохранить корректность сведений и точность завершения задач money x.